Basics
There ClubHouses provide a central meeting place for Club Leaders and
Club Members to host exclusive group events. In order to rent a
ClubHouse you must assign it to an already existing Club. Only Club
Leaders can rent ClubHouse Zones.
There ClubHouses are pre-fabricated dwellings created by There with a
limited style of structures. They are stationary Zones that cannot be
moved. Rent is taken from the owner of the ClubHouse automatically
every thirty days. There ClubHouses are available on the following
islands: Caldera, Motu Motu, Ootay and Tyr.
There ClubHouses allow for interior decorating only, which means there
is not outside yard available for decorating.You may change the wall,
floor, door, ceiling, window and hearth decorations in addition to the
30 drops you can use for furniture and other items. (Excluding
non-decoratable Huts and Performance Stages)
There ClubHouses are private (Excluding Huts), which means members
standing outside of the Zone cannot read your text bubbles or hear
voice.
Types of ClubHouses
There are three types of ClubHouses to rent in There. The
basic ClubHouse
is a large decoratable Zone, which allows a capacity of up to 50
avatars with Vehicles turned off. The second type of ClubHouse is a
large
Performance Stage
Zone with an avatar capacity of 12. This stage comes equipped with
lavish décor and a podium with group seating. The third type of
ClubHouse is a
Hut.
Huts are exterior zones that cannot be decorated with furniture or wall
hangings. They are open air areas containing four wooden chairs and a
table. Huts hold up to a maximum of eight people.
ClubHouse Ownership
Unlike a ThereHouse or a FunZone, ClubHouses do not have deeds. They
are designed to link to a club or group. ClubHouses cannot be traded,
auctioned or given to other members. When you no longer wish to pay
rent on a ClubHouse you must cancel the rental. If you cancel rent on
your ClubHouse it will be listed on the market for other members to
rent.
When you rent a ClubHouse the Zone will show up in your My Things menu. The only option listed in the Zone menu is
Configure. Clicking on Configure launches the ClubHouse details page where you can change the details and permissions of the Zone.
Renting a ClubHouse
Please note that in order to rent a ClubHouse a group or club must be set up before the Zone rental can take place. To
create a group or club on your toolbar go to
People>Find a Group.
On the group home page you can form a team, start a business, create a
club, establish a household, or organize your community.
Click here for additional information on how to set up a Club or group in There.
You can find available ClubHouses to rent on the
Places Search Page.
On your toolbar go to
Places>Find a Place>Search Listings. Check the box “Include only places you can rent”. Click on the
ClubHouse tab to find available houses.
You can narrow your search by region, location, description or cost of rent.
If you see a ClubHouse listed that you are interested in click
Visit to view the location. It is a good idea to check out the Zone and its location before you rent it.
When you visit a ClubHouse location you will teleport to the outside of
the front door. You will need to click on the action tag on the door to
enter the ClubHouse.
Once inside if you would like to rent the property, click
This Place>Info about “For Rent” on your toolbar.
The ClubHouse Detail Page will appear. Click
Rent It to begin the rental process.
Make sure to read the
Rental Agreement. You will need to assign the ClubHouse a Club. Again, you must be the leader of the Club. Next to
Rent for Club
there is a drop down menu which will display all of the Clubs that you
are a Leader of. Click the appropriate Club you are renting the Zone
for and then click
I Agree to rent the ClubHouse. Click
Set Up Your Place to get started.

Group Permissions
Club Members have the ability to decorate and host events in the
ClubHouse. Avatars who are not members of the associated Club do not
have decorating privileges or hosting rights in the ClubHouse.
The Club Leader controls the hosting and decorating privileges through the
Administration link
on the Club homepage, not to be confused with the ClubHouse details
page. The Club homepage can be accessed through your avatar’s profile.
When you go into the Administration link on the homepage of your club
or group, you will be able to configure what permissions the members of
your club or group can have.
Under
Group Permissions on the Administration link on the Club homepage, check the option
Decorate ClubHouse and
Hold Events In ClubHouse if you want to give the Club members Zone decorating and hosting privileges.
Remember to click
Save Changes to update any information you have changed.
Decorating Your ClubHouse
Now for the fun part! Now that you’ve gone through the process of
renting and setting up your ClubHouse, you can decorate the Zone with
items from the
Home and Garden category in
Shop Central or in
Auctions.
Transform the interior of your ClubHouse by changing the walls,
ceiling, floor, panels, hearth and windows. You can purchase these
items in the
Home Improvement category in
Shop Central or in
Auctions.
Walls, ceilings, floors, panels, hearths and windows do not contribute to the 30-limit drop count in your Zone.
To change the look and feel of your ClubHouse go to
This Place on your menu bar and click
Show Action Tags.
Run your mouse over the action tag on the wall, ceiling, floor, panel,
hearth or windows of your home to change the object. Click
Show Choices to view your options. You can always purchase additional Home Improvement items for a wider selection of options.
Items such as furniture, decorations, ornaments and group seating
deduct from your 30-limit drop count. Because ClubHouses have a drop
count limit, it is a good idea to budget the amount of items you drop
in your Zone. For example, you can purchase a refrigerator (1 drop), a
stove (1 drop), and kitchen cabinets (1 drop), which would add up to an
amount of 3 drops. Some developers offer “1-drop” sets to help with
drop budgeting, so you can purchase a “1-drop kitchen set” that
contains all 3 items, saving yourself 2 drops. The drops you save can
be used to furnish your ClubHouse with additional ornaments or
knick-knacks.
There keeps track of your drop count automatically. To check how many
drops you have left at any given time, visit your Zone and go to your
Menu Bar > This Place > Gear. The amount of remaining drops will be displayed in the Gear menu.
Placing Items In Your ClubHouse
There’s decorating tools let you find just the right place to put your items. The
Take One Out
command allows you to view the item and move it around to get a good
idea of what it will look like in the space before you actually place
or “drop” the item.
To
Take One Out in your ClubHouse go to your Menu Bar and click:
This Place > Gear > Structures > (Item Name) > Take One Out
When you have positioned your item just where you want it, you can
“drop” in place by moving your mouse cursor over the decorating action
tag and click
Place Here.
It might take a few tries to find the right location for you item. Try
dropping the item and then stand back to look at it to see if you like
its position.
If you have already dropped the item and need to change the position you must
Pick Up the item to make necessary changes.
Go to your tool bar and click:
This Place > Gear > Structures > (Item Name) > Pick Up
Once the item has been picked up you can raise and lower the item with the
(+) and (-) key on your desktop’s numerical keypad.
To raise the item click +. To lower the item click -.
On a laptop hold the blue text “Fn” key down while pressing the blue
text “+” key aka “?” key to budge the object up. Hold the blue text
“Fn” key down while pressing the blue text “-“ aka “ ;” key. You can
adjust the positioning with these small “nudges” until you’re satisfied
with its location. When you’ve got the item exactly where you want it,
click
Place Here.
Removing Items from Your ClubHouse
You can
Put Away an item after you have dropped it and replace it into your inventory. Go to your Menu Bar and click:
This Place > Gear > Item>Pick Up > Put Away
Repeat the easy drop process for all items you would like to include in your ClubHouse.
During the decorating phase it is best to keep the
Decorating Tags turned on so that you can move or remove items at will. To turn the
Decorating Tags on go to your Menu Bar and click:
This Place > Show Decorate Tags
Layout Options gives you the freedom to save and drop your placed items easily. Go to your Menu Bar and click:
This Place > Layout Option
♦
Clear Layout allows you to remove all dropped objects in your
House all at once. A pop up menu will ask you to verify if you want to
clear the entire layout of your Zone.
♦
Freeze Layout lets you freeze (save) items in a particular
spot. For example if you have an item hovering in the air, you can
choose the Freeze option to save it in that location.
♦
Remove Foreign Object allows you to remove items such as scrolls or books left in your House by other members.
♦
Load Layout allows you to choose from your saved options. A
pop up menu will ask you if you would like to load pieces to their
original locations or to a position relative to where you are standing.
The existing layout will be cleared if you choose one of the two
options.
♦
Save Layout gives you the option to save the position of
dropped items in your ThereHouse. You are allowed 50 empty saved
options, which you will need to rename.

Keeping Track of Your ClubHouse Rental Period
To view your
Rental Period information Page, make sure you are within the boundaries of your ClubHouse, then go to your Menu Bar and choose
This Place > Info About “Your” House> Descripton Page.
At the bottom of the Description Page you will see information
regarding your rental period for the amount due on a thirty-day basis.
Extend Rental
You can pay a month of rent in advance with our
Extend Rental feature. The pre-paid rental period will start at the end of your current 30-day rental period.
On your Menu Bar choose
This Place>Info about "Your" Lot> Extend Rental>Rent It>I Agree
Please note that you cannot extend your rental on the very first day of
your initial rental period. Wait a few days into the first 30-day
rental cycle before you extend your rent.
Cancel Rental
If you wish to cancel your ClubHouse rental, you may do so by going to your
ClubHouse Details page.
This Place>Info About “Your” ClubHouse>Cancel Rental>I agree
You must confirm the cancellation of your rental. No refunds are
available. If you have been charged for the current month’s rent you
will not receive a partial refund.
Your Club will stay intact if you cancel rent on your ClubHouse.
